WebFeb 5, 2011 · Physical organic chemistry can be defined as the study of organic chemistry in terms of the principles of physical chemistry. We can put this definition in perspective by depicting a Venn diagram which shows how the fields are connected (see Fig. 2.1).

Oxidations of aldehydes and ketones. Aldehydes can be oxidized to carboxylic acid with both mild and strong oxidizing agents. However, ketones can be oxidized to various types of compounds only by ...
